WEEKEND ROUND UP SAT 28TH JAN

WEEKEND ROUND UP SAT 28TH JAN image

The Under 14s produced the club's peformance of the weekend when they came back from two goals down to win 6-2 aganst Trojans in the National League.

What started as a pretty dour encounter between the under 14’s and Trojans from Londonderry exploded into life after the reds had went two down and Owen Marquess in Carniny’s goal saved a penalty and under 13 player Conor Doherty was introduced. In a thrilling second period Carniny came back to win 6-2 courtesy of a Shevlin hat trick, a brace from Doherty and a headed goal from Hart although the whole team can be proud of their performance.

Conal McHenry proved to be the hero for the under 12s netting a last minute equaliser to earn his side a 1-1 draw in their National League tie against Magherafelt Sky Blues.

The young under 10s also had a fun day’s football with both Carniny sides defeating Coleraine at Ballymena Showgrounds in a mini soccer tourney with their friends from the Bann.

As the 11s and 13s games were postponed due to frost the 15s went out of the NL Cup 4-3 away to Ballinamallard.

Only one of the clubs senior sides was in action with the 'Seconds' having a comforatble 5-1 win against 14th Newtownabbey.

SPECIAL VISIT

Carniny Amateur & Youth FC under 14s welcomed a very special visitor into their changing room on Saturday morning prior to their National League tie with Trojans in the form of recently appointed Ballymena United manager, Glen Ferguson. Glen didn’t hesitate in accepting the offer and passed on good advice to the boys which must have worked as they won 6-2.

BIG NIGHT FOR CARNINY STAFF

Club Chairman, Anthony McCartney and coach Cliffy Adams both were involved in Ballymena Borough Councils Sports Awards last week. Unfortunately both came runners up but both should be proud of the fact they were nominated for such prestigious awards.
